Enact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: ACT) in Raleigh, NC, is seeking a Legal & Compliance Intern to gain hands-on experience in a corporate legal and regulatory environment.
You will support contract management system implementation, regulatory research, policy validation, and cross-functional projects while learning from experienced attorneys and compliance professionals. This 12-week program emphasizes ownership, collaboration, and professional development in a hybrid on-site schedule.

Enact Holdings, Inc. (Nasdaq: ACT), operating primarily through its wholly owned subsidiaries, is a leading publicly traded U.S. private mortgage insurance provider, offering borrower‑centric products that enable lenders and other partners across the U.S. to help people responsibly achieve and maintain the dream of homeownership. By empowering customers and their borrowers, Enact seeks to positively impact the lives of those in the communities in which it serves in a sustainable way. Genworth Financial, Inc (“Genworth”) (NYSE: GNW) is a Fortune 1000 company focused on empowering families to navigate the aging journey with confidence, now and in the future. Headquartered in Richmond, Virginia, Genworth and its CareScout businesses provide guidance, products, and services that help people understand their caregiving options and fund their long‑term care needs. Genworth is also the parent company and majority‑owner of publicly traded Enact Holdings, Inc. (Nasdaq: ACT), a leading U.S. mortgage insurance provider. Genworth Mexico Genworth US
